Planning staff presented a rezoning and future land‑use amendment request for 309 Pollock Street, a vacant quarter‑acre parcel, asking the board to consider reclassifying the lot from R8 residential to Cedar Street Mixed Use (CSMU). Staff said the requested change would align the lot with adjacent CSMU parcels and reviewed lot width, setback and buffer differences between R8 and CSMU design standards.
Staff cautioned that the site is an interior lot (not a corner parcel) and that any commercial or mixed‑use development adjacent to residential parcels would require appropriate buffers under the CSMU standards. The board heard the presentation; further analysis and public hearing scheduling are expected as the application proceeds through the formal rezoning process.
